NEG-ERR: state the relay's max_sync_events on an overflow refusal
A client that is refused for matching too much has exactly one thing to decide — how much smaller to ask next time — and no way to find out. NIP-11 has no field for max_sync_events, so the only route to a window the relay will answer is to guess and halve, and every wrong guess costs the relay the snapshot scan that produces the refusal. strfry already states the number in its rejection text; this makes it a first-class part of the frame. ["NEG-ERR", <subId>, <reason>] unchanged, still what NIP-77 says ["NEG-ERR", <subId>, <reason>, <cap>] when the refusal is about size Both mappers write the fourth element only when there is one, so a refusal with nothing to state is byte-identical to before, and both tolerate a non-numeric fourth element from someone else's relay. NegErrMessage.statedCap reads either form — the wire field or strfry's "(2431002 > 1000000)" prose — but only for a refusal that is about SIZE. That gate is the point of the property: a rate limit or a quota can carry numbers too, and it does not shrink when the window shrinks, so a client that mistook one for a cap would shrink its windows forever against a relay that has no size limit at all. The relay side sends its own configured cap for the same reason it is cheap: it had to know the number to refuse.
